RESERVE AND AUXILIARY FORCES
Part VI of the Reserve and Auxiliary Forces (Protection of Civil Interests) Act, 1951, inter alia enables the owner of an industrial assurance policy or other life or endowment policy effected with a collecting friendly society to obtain protection for his policy, subject to certain conditions, if he is unable to pay the premiums thereon as a result of service, whether performed by the owner or by another, in the Reserve and Auxiliary Forces.
